Three-alarm blaze guts office building in downtown Macon

MACON - Investigators are trying to determine the cause of a fire Thursday night at a two-story office building in downtown Macon that housed a cab company and shoe store. <br>
<br>
A December 27 fire that damaged three other buildings has been classified as suspicous by state Insurance and Safety Fire Commissioner John Oxendine. <br>
<br>
Officials say firefighters responded to a call last night around 10:30 p.m. The three-alarm blaze gutted the building but no serious injuries were reported. <br>
<br>
District fire chief Donald Braswell says, ``It looks like it was pretty advanced when we got there. It took approximately an hour to an hour and half to bring it under control.'' <br>
<br>
He says 60-65 firefighters were on the scene.
